SHELVES: with or without grill.
Due to the special guides the
shelves are removable and the
height is adjustable (see
diagram), allowing easy storage
of large containers and food.
Height can be adjusted without
complete removal of the shelf.
FRESH BOX: for fresh meat and
fish. Due to the compartments
low temperature (the coldest in
the refrigerator) and to the clear
door that provides protection
against oxidation and blackening,
food can be stored for even up to
one week. It can also be used for
cold meals.
MULTI-USE bin: to store food
(such as cold meats) for a long
time and also prevent odours
from lingering in the refrigerator. It
can be removed for use and it
may be shifted sideways to
optimise space (see diagram).
and VEGETABLE bin
The salad crispers fitted inside the
fridge have been specially
designed for the purpose of
keeping fruit and vegetables fresh
and crisp. Open the humidity
regulator (position B) if you want
to store food in a less humid
environment, or close it (position
A) to store food in a more humid
environment.
The easy-to-open lids (all you
have to do is pull the crisper out)
make it easy to put food in and
take it out.
Start-up and use
Starting the appliance
! Before starting the appliance, follow the
installation instructions (see Installation).
! Before connecting the appliance, clean the
compartments and accessories well with lukewarm water
and bicarbonate.
! The appliance comes with a motor protection control
system which makes the compressor start approximately 8
minutes after being switched on. The compressor also
starts each time the power supply is cut off whether
voluntarily or involuntarily (blackout).
1. Set the FREEZER OPERATION knob on
.
2. Insert the plug into the socket and ensure that the green
POWER indicator light illuminates.
3. Turn the REFRIGERATOR OPERATION knob to an
average value. After a few hours you will be able to put
food in the refrigerator.
4. Turn the FREEZER OPERATION knob to an average
value and press the SUPER FREEZE button (rapid
freezing): the SUPER FREEZE indicator light will
illuminate. Once the refrigerator has reached the optimal
temperature, the indicator light goes out and you can
begin food storage.
Using the refrigerator to its full potential
No Frost
The No Frost system
circulates cold air
continuously to collect
humidity and prevent ice
and frost formation. The
system maintains an
optimal humidity level in
the compartment,
preserving the original
quality of the food,
preventing the food from
sticking together and making defrosting a thing of the past.
Do not block the aeration cells by placing food or
containers in direct contact with the refrigerating back
panel. Close bottles and wrap food tightly.
Use the REFRIGERATOR OPERATION knob to adjust
the temperature (see Description).
Press the SUPER COOL button (rapid cooling) to lower
the temperature quickly. For example, when you place a
large number of new food items inside a fridge the
internal temperature will rise slightly. The function
quickly cools the groceries by temporarily reducing the
temperature until it reaches the ideal level.
Place only cold or lukewarm foods in the compartment,
not hot foods (see Precautions and tips).
Remember that cooked foods do not last longer than
raw foods.
Do not store liquids in open containers. They will
increase humidity in the refrigerator and cause
condensation to form.
